ramips: ramips_esw: fix typos
authorGabor Juhos <juhosg@openwrt.org>
Tue, 4 Jan 2011 13:44:05 +0000 (13:44 +0000)
committerGabor Juhos <juhosg@openwrt.org>
Tue, 4 Jan 2011 13:44:05 +0000 (13:44 +0000)
Patch from #8577.

SVN-Revision: 24898

target/linux/ramips/files/drivers/net/ramips_esw.c

index 18e5fa5..df567a7 100644 (file)
@@ -5,7 +5,7 @@
 
 #define RT305X_ESW_REG_FCT0            0x08
 #define RT305X_ESW_REG_PFC1            0x14
-#define RT305X_ESW_REG_PVIDC(_n)       (0x48 + 4 * (_n))
+#define RT305X_ESW_REG_PVIDC(_n)       (0x40 + 4 * (_n))
 #define RT305X_ESW_REG_VLANI(_n)       (0x50 + 4 * (_n))
 #define RT305X_ESW_REG_VMSC(_n)                (0x70 + 4 * (_n))
 #define RT305X_ESW_REG_FPA             0x84
@@ -172,7 +172,7 @@ rt305x_esw_set_pvid(struct rt305x_esw *esw, unsigned port, unsigned pvid)
        s = RT305X_ESW_PVIDC_PVID_S * (port % 2);
        rt305x_esw_rmw(esw,
                       RT305X_ESW_REG_PVIDC(port / 2),
-                      RT305X_ESW_PVIDC_PVID_S << s,
+                      RT305X_ESW_PVIDC_PVID_M << s,
                       (pvid & RT305X_ESW_PVIDC_PVID_M) << s);
 }